What You Should Know When Replacing Your Roof

Posted on

It’s time to replace your roof. This is a big undertaking, and the decision will last for years or possibly the rest of your life. If you’re considering replacing your roof, check out these four facts you must know first, so you make an informed decision. Some Materials Don’t Work on Low Roofs Depending on the slope of your roof, there are some materials you just shouldn’t use. Asphalt and metal are fine whether you have a low roof or steep roof because they do a good job of blocking rain and allowing it to slide off with ease.…

The Threat Of The Emerald Ash Borer: What Canadian Homeowners Need To Know

Posted on

In many parts of Canada, the ash tree is a familiar part of the landscape, but this much-loved species is under threat from a foreign invader. The emerald ash borer first arrived in Canada more than a decade ago, and this innocuous green beetle now threatens millions of trees. If you have ash trees on your property, learn more about the threat from the emerald ash borer, and find out what you may need to do to control the spread of this voracious pest.…
